
A fresh power tussle is reportedly brewing in the All Progressives Congress, APC, over the Chairmanship of its Board of Trustees. The tussle, according to Punch, was between former Vice-President Atiku Abubakar and a former Chairman of the party, Chief Bisi Akande. The tussle is said to be part of moves by the power blocs in the APC to influence decisions in the party by taking control of its various organs. Two power blocs led by Atiku and a National Leader of the party, Asiwaju Bola Tinubu, have been engaged in a fierce battle to control the party. The two camps are said to be eyeing the BoT Chairmanship as they believe it would go a long way in assisting them to control the party.
The Chairman of the BOT, according to the APC constitution, shall be elected by the board members. Both camps are reported to have started reaching out to members of the board, who would elect the Chairman.
According to sources “Akande was being backed by Tinubu, who is not happy with Atiku’s role in the National Assembly leadership elections.
Investigations revealed that During the National Assembly leadership elections, Atiku allegedly backed Saraki and the Speaker of the House of Representatives, Mr. Yakubu Dogara, while Tinubu and the party’s National Working Committee were said to have backed Senator Ahmad Lawan and Mr. Femi Gbajabiamila for the senate presidency and the speakership. However, both candidates lost to Saraki and Dogara during the elections.
Following Saraki’s emergence as the senate president, the Atiku bloc would now be able to take control of the party’s National Executive Committee.
The Senate President and the Speaker of the House of Representatives automatically become members of the party’s NEC.
Tinubu is in control of the party’s NWC as many of its members are said to be loyal to him. However, the contest for the control of the BOT is still open to the two camps. A close associate of Akande, Mr. Adelani Baderinwa, said that he was not aware that the former governor of Osun State was being nominated to be the Chairman of the BOT of the ruling party.
Baderinwa, who was the former chief press secretary of Akande when he was the governor, said, “Chief Bisi Akande is eminently qualified to be BOT chairman of the APC. He was a Chairman of the Alliance for Democracy; he was the Chairman of Action Congress of Nigeria and was the Interim Chairman of the APC. “Before this, you will remember that he was a deputy governor and later he became the governor of Osun State. “ If you are talking about Nigeria, he knows Nigeria very well and his integrity is unquestionable and he is an experienced politician.” In addition, the Managing Director of the Atiku Media Office, Mr. Paul Ibe, said, he was not aware that the party had announced a vacancy for the position in question. He said, “Like I have said elsewhere before, we are not aware that the APC has thrown open the race for the chairmanship of the party’s BoT. “But if in the wisdom of the party, it elects to appoint Abubakar as the Chairman of its BoT, the Turaki Adamawa will be amenable and well-disposed to it because he is eminently qualified to offer his services to the party at that level.”
